Finance Review — Supplier Renewal. The Varnholt Packaging contract renews in Q3. Unit costs rose 4% year on year; volume rebates offset roughly half. Delivery performance acceptable: 96% on-time across all branches. Recommendation: renew for 12 months, not 24, pending the Keldway tender outcome. Branch managers should hold ordering patterns steady until the renewal is signed. Further detail on direction is noted below.

confidential, hahop-bajep: Gross margin on Ralath came in at 5 percent against a plan of 10 percent. Only 9 of the 100 pilot accounts renewed Ralath, so a churn review is set for April 1.

# Approvals: TrailGlass Audit-Log Viewer

Welcome to the team. Any change to TrailGlass — the internal viewer for audit events — requires a documented approval before merge. This includes filter logic, retention display rules, and export features, since auditors at our Delmont office rely on the tool for compliance reviews. Open a review request, attach screenshots of affected views, and wait for explicit approval; silence is not consent. All approval requests should be routed to the reviewer named below.

account owner for bawip-tahag: Raleth Quenok

Off-site run — Kellerby Open regional chess final

☐ Score sheets: collect the full set from the arbiter's table at the Dunwall Community Hall, including the two disputed games from board 4. Keep them flat in the grey folio, not folded — the federation scans them and creases ruin the notation. Count should be 96 sheets; confirm against the pairing list before leaving. The federation rep was twitchy about chain of custody, so dispatch needs to brief the rider carefully. The confidential hand-over line sits just below.

handover note for yagef-bagep: the drudor pelius courier leaves the kasdor zorvan norir ledger at gate 8016 under passcode 755406